Oven-Baked Chicken Thighs with Mayonnaise and Garlic
A quick, tasty, filling dinner! Mayonnaise works great for marinating and baking meat because it soaks into the fibers well. Any chicken parts can be used, but here’s a grandma-style option: chicken thighs with mayonnaise and garlic baked in the oven. Give it a try!

Preparation
Step 1
How to bake chicken thighs with mayonnaise and garlic in the oven? Prepare all the necessary ingredients. Rinse the chicken thighs under running water and pat d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ture.
Step 2
Peel the onion and garlic and rinse them. Press the garlic through a garlic press. Finely chop the onion. In a bowl, mix mayonnaise, onion, and garlic. Add a little salt and spices to taste. For spices, I use a bit of ground pepper and paprika.
Step 3
Add the prepared chicken thighs to the bowl and coat them well on all sides with the mayonnaise sauce. If you have time, let the chicken marinate for 1-2 hours. If not, you can bake it right away.
Step 4
Use any oven-safe baking dish - ceramic, glass, or metal. Grease the bottom and sides with vegetable oil and place the chicken in it along with all the sauce and onion. Spread the sauce evenly over the chicken. Bake in an oven preheated to 200°C (392°F) for 35-40 minutes, adjusting to your oven.
Step 5
During baking, the thighs will brown and turn an appetizing golden color. Remove the dish from the oven and serve hot. You can bring it to the table in the same dish, or plate it and add any side dish you like.
